Abstract

Two-way product-and-forward(PF)relay networks can provide lower asymptotic symbol-error rate(SER)than amplify-and-forward(AF)relay networks.In order to study the performance of PF re-lay networks over Rayleigh fading channels,the asymptotic SER expression of the PF relay networks is derived and analytical results show that PF relay networks have better SER performance than AF relay networks.Experimental results agree well with the analytical results.In order to enhance the SER per-formance of PF relay networks,a power allocation algorithm to minimize SER under total transmit power constraint is proposed.Simulations show that proposed algorithm can significantly enhance the SER per-formance.
